>>>>> "Doug" == Douglas Schaefer <dschaefe@xxxxxxxxxx> writes:
Doug> I'm trying to get the builds going again and noticed a new jar file in
Doug> debug.core, cdi.jar. There's no problem adding a new jar file, however,
Doug> there are classes in the cdi source folder that still refer to the src
Doug> source folder and, thus, fail to build.
I meant to mention that I ran into this. I worked around it with the
appended patch -- probably bogus.
Now I wonder whether I really have the 2.0 sources. I suspect the
releng code that checks out the map files again fetched HEAD and not
CDT_2_0.
It would be really convenient for me if the map files were updated to
refer to a release tag, and then the releng plugin itself were tagged
with that same tag. Then, I think, fetching a particular release
would be very simple: check out the releng plugin with a given tag,
then run the fetch target to get the correct versions of all the
plugins.
What do you think?
